Bitcoin vs. Ethereum: A Trading Showdown

The digital asset world is a dynamic landscape, with numerous players vying for attention. Among these, BTC and Ethereum stand out as the most dominant. Both have established a strong foothold in the market, but their different characteristics make them suitable for various trading strategies. Bitcoin, known for its finite nature, often serves as a safe haven. In contrast, Ethereum's smart contract capabilities open doors to a more diverse ecosystem, attracting developers and investors seeking high returns.

Decoding Decentralization: The Future of copyright Trading

The landscape of copyright trading is rapidly shifting, driven by the potential of decentralization. This innovative concept disrupts traditional financial frameworks by granting autonomy individuals and eliminating the need for traditional authorities. With its ability to encourage transparency, protection, and accessibility, decentralization is poised to revolutionize the future of copyright trading.

As blockchain technology check here progresses, decentralized exchanges (DEXs) are attaining momentum, offering peer-to-peer trading without the need for intermediaries. This transition empowers traders to carry out transactions directly with each other, lowering fees and enhancing control. Furthermore, decentralized finance (DeFi) platforms are gaining traction, offering a variety of financial services, such as lending, borrowing, and yield farming, all built on the principles of decentralization.
